Crazy Crocs »
New Arcades: Hub Zero (Dubai); Frolics (Toronto); Dave & Busters (Various)
It’s time for some news on fresh arcade locations that are open out there, let’s start with a couple on the international circuit: Hub Zero (Dubai) – We mentioned this one a few months
Read More »